Output ec8bcf69151bcd6df1215f5ed0aea86fe010956374819a1f542b97d8b1fae942:52

value
190265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fe02cf0febb7c3cab5072280a8b5e2b9d1c032 OP_EQUAL
address
35RmFD4NGdjWw4FQP8CbE7AFnQ6Hia5Xp1
transaction
ec8bcf69151bcd6df1215f5ed0aea86fe010956374819a1f542b97d8b1fae942